4 Calibration / Deskew
Procedure
The Calibration/Deskew procedure described in this chapter is applicable to both
N2830/1/2A and N7000/1/2/3A InfiniiMax III+ probes.
The probe calibration and deskew is a guided procedure that you start from the
oscilloscope's Probe Calibration dialog box. Depending on the oscilloscope model,
you will be instructed to connect the probe head to either of the following
oscilloscope outputs:
• Front-panel Probe Comp terminals
• Aux Out BNC connector or Cal Out connector using the N5443A
Calibration/Deskew Fixture with 50W termination.
